New Breakthroughs in IVF Technology Are Making Fertility Treatment More Precise

  Advancements in medical technology are reshaping the future of fertility care. In recent years, new breakthroughs in in vitro fertilization have made fertility treatment more precise, personalized, and effectiveoffering renewed hope to individuals and couples facing infertility.

IVF

  From Standardized IVF to Precision Fertility Care

  Traditional IVF treatments often relied on generalized protocols that worked well for some patients, but not all. Today, advances in reproductive medicine are enabling physicians to move beyond one-size-fits-all approaches.By tailoring treatment more accurately, doctors can improve outcomes while reducing unnecessary interventions.Breakthroughs in Embryo Assessment and Selection, One of the most significant advances in IVF technology lies in embryo evaluation. New imaging and monitoring technologies now allow embryologists to observe embryo development continuously without disturbing the culture environment.These technologies provide deeper insight into embryo viability, helping clinicians select embryos with the highest implantation potential.

  Genetic Testing for More Informed Decisions

  Preimplantation Genetic Testing has become more advanced and precise, allowing doctors to screen embryos for chromosomal abnormalities and specific genetic conditions before transfer. When used appropriately, genetic testing contributes to safer and more predictable IVF outcomes.

  Artificial Intelligence and Data-Driven IVF

  Artificial intelligence is playing an increasingly important role in fertility treatment. By analyzing large datasets from previous IVF cycles, AI-assisted tools can help identify patterns that may not be visible to the human eye.While AI does not replace medical expertise, it provides valuable support in delivering more accurate and consistent care.

  Personalized Ovarian Stimulation Protocols

  Advances in hormonal monitoring and pharmacology have led to more precise ovarian stimulation strategies. Instead of aggressive stimulation for all patients, doctors can now adjust medication types, dosages, and timing based on individual responses.

  Improving Outcomes While Prioritizing Patient Well-Being

  Modern IVF breakthroughs focus not only on success rates, but also on patient experience and long-term health. Shorter treatment cycles, better monitoring, and improved communication tools help reduce stress and uncertainty for patients.
